<p>Everyone hopes to get a good workout in but it&#8217;s also important to find ways to <strong>make it enjoyable</strong>, rather than feeling like a chore.</p>
<p>
<p>If your workouts have felt more like a chore than anything else lately, it might be time to take stock of when and where (and how) you&#8217;re actually doing your routines.</p>
<p>
<p>Do you go to the same gym, day in and day out, same familiar surroundings, same familiar faces, and do the same familiar exercises?  <img alt='Treadmill Workout Boring' src='http://www.girlwithnoname.com/images/Treadmill-Workout-Boring.jpg' align='right' width='141' height='150' style="border-style: none"/></p>
<p>
<p>Are your cardio workouts almost always done on the <strong>same old treadmill, elliptical or stationery cycle staring at the same old tv show</strong> on the screen above the machine?  And, usually without volume too, am I right?</p>
<p>
<p>Wow, that does sound pretty darn boring.  <em>I&#8217;d consider that a &#8216;chore&#8217; too</em>, so you sure aren&#8217;t alone in what you&#8217;re feeling.</p>
<p>
<p>How about this?  Try getting your cardio outdoors wherever possible.  </p>
<p>
<p>And don&#8217;t just change your venue from indoors to outdoors, <em>change the time of day you get out there and you might find it that much more enjoyable</em>.</p>
<p>
<p>If you like to run, cycle or powerwalk try getting out for your <strong>cardio session first thing in the morning and enjoy watching the sun come up</strong> as you&#8217;re getting your heart rate up too!  </p>
<p><img alt='Sunrise Running' src='http://www.girlwithnoname.com/images/Sunrise-Running.jpg' align='left' width='106' height='128' style="border-style: none"/></p>
<p>Skip wearing your mp3 player for a change and listen to the music of the outdoors, like birds chirping and relish watching the sky turn from dim to bright.  That sounds like fun inspiration to me!</p>
<p>
<p>What about heading out just before sunset and enjoy watching the sky turn crimson during your run, as the sun sinks out of sight for another day.  What a GREAT way to end a day:  doing a good thing for your health and enjoying fantastic scenery as you go.  </p>
<p>
<p>If you can&#8217;t get out there with the sunrise or sunset, then try hitting your local park and run, walk or cycle on the paths, or even get your shoes off and go for a run at your local beach, in the sand (<em>sand running is a great workout, too &#8230; see:  <a href="http://www.girlwithnoname.com/2010/05/jack-up-your-running-routines/">Jack Up Your Running Routines</a></em>).</p>
<p>
<p><em>Heck, you could even do some great weights routines outdoors using just your bodyweight.</em></p>
<p>
<p>Try some <strong>SuperCircuits incorporating a bunch of different bodyweight moves</strong>.  You don&#8217;t even need any equipment (<em>and just as well, because it could be a problem to carry it out there if your equipment is particularly heavy or large</em>). </p>
<p><img alt='Park Bench Decline Pushup' src='http://www.girlwithnoname.com/images/Park-Bench-Decline-Pushup.jpg' align='right' width='150' height='112' style="border-style: none"/></p>
<p>Try getting to a park and just doing a routine with burpees or squat thrusts, mountain climbers and breakdancers, jumping jacks, bodyweight squats, walking lunges (go backwards and forwards), push-ups or bench dips on a park bench, pull-ups on the playground monkey bars and jumps up onto a park bench.</p>
<p>
<p>Or take a jump rope with you and jump until you feel like you just can&#8217;t jump anymore.  That will get your heart rate up and your blood pumping in no time, and it&#8217;s dead-simple.</p>
<p>
<p><em>You could even go climb a tree if you felt particularly youthful and full of whimsy that day (and can find a suitable tree) &#8230; hee hee &#8230; what fun!</em>  </p>
<p>
<p>So, don&#8217;t get trapped in a web of boredom by working out at the same time, in the same place, on the same equipment, doing the same moves all the time.  </p>
<p>
<p>Change your surroundings or change the time of day and you&#8217;ll be interested and energized all over again!</p>

<p><b><font size="3">7 Excellent Blogs About Power Walking</b></font></p>
<p>Power walking has really gained popularity as a sport and exercise of choice. As it is usually easier on the body but yet still offers an excellent workout, people of all ages and walks of life can be a part of it. Of course, anything with that large a following also comes with info-seekers and with others who like to share their experiences in the blogosphere, and so to link the two, and introduce more of you to a highly beneficial fitness medium, here we look at some of the most essential blogs to follow.</p>
<p><b>7 Top Blog Resources For Powerwalking</b></p>
<p>1.	<a href="http://walking.about.com/b/">Walktopia </a>.- By far the most comprehensive blog dedicated to the power walker or anybody interested in the sport. This offers commentaries, real life adventures, tips, and a comprehensive overview of what power walking is and what it means to those involved. </p>
<p>2.	<a href="http://www.wonderwalkers.co.nz/">Wonder Walkers </a>– This is more than a blog, it’s a community of power walkers all trying to work together as a giant resource. This is well worth following and you can find some of the many useful tools and ideas to work to your advantage as a power walker. This comes from people who understand that power walking is truly a sport and physical activity that gives great exercise and mental health as well.</p>
<p>3.	<a href="http://www.charitywalksblog.com/">Charity Walks </a>– As many power walkers are often involved in charity walks, this can be a really helpful and informative site. Not only can this help the individual who is organizing a charity walk, but it can help those who are trying to raise funds through their efforts. It can also serve as an inspiration and an idea builder for the power walker who wants to put her talent to good use.</p>
<p>4.	<a href="http://nordic-walking-usa.blogspot.com/">Nordic Walking </a>– This may be focused on a particular segment of walking involving the Nordic pole, but it can benefit any power walker at the core. It can introduce a different type of walking or just simply serve as an inspiration for the power walker at heart who is passionate about her sport. This is an excellent blog to follow to keep motivated or to try something new.</p>
<p>5.	<a href="http://fitness-walking.findfastr.com/">Fitness Walking </a>–This is an excellent blog chock full of information for the power walker. You can learn all about power walking if you are a novice or reiterate your interest in just how walking can really do wonders for your fitness and go easy on your body in the process. This is highly recommended for the power walker at any level.</p>
<p>6.	<a href="http://www.lindalemke.com/blog/">Nordic Walking Queen </a>– Though this too is based on the art of Nordic walking, it too can serve as an inspiration to the power walker at any level. You can keep up with the accomplishments, track the progress, and see everyday accounts of what it is like to be a power walker at your best. She offers a very real and down to earth perspective to keep readers captivated.</p>
<p>7.	<a href="http://fixingyourfeet.com/blog/">Fixing Your Feet</a>—Perhaps a more remote type of blog, but nonetheless important for the power walker. This focuses on the importance of picking the right footwear and taking care of your feet for the power walker who puts some serious miles on in this sport.     </p>
<p>If powerwalking is your thing, you&#8217;re bound to love these blogs.  If you&#8217;re just learning about the benefits of powerwalking, these blogs will help immensely.  The collected knowledge of these bloggers is putting power walking on the map, and enhancing the experience for all.<br />
